Well I was gutted that when the paranormal team came to the pub, I had a meeting at work I couldn't avoid- gutted disgust.gif

But from what I've been told so far, the pub is indeed 'very active'.

Just from what I remember as it was a lot to take in at one

They've identified where the pub structure was different in years gone by, which I can investigate to see if that's accurate

They picked up on the man who "is always walking in and out" through the main door

There is a little girl upstairs in the living quarters, although none of the family have picked up on her upstairs, but we don't think it's the same little girl my friend saw and who we suspect was blowing her hair downstairs.

There is a benevolent lady who occupies the bedroom and she is looking after my mate, this is the calmness we have both felt in that room. She's a very positive entity.

They picked up on some kind of activity upstairs, people rushing about, and sensed it was in relation to something quite tragic relating to a family. Maybe the loss of a child or similar.

A lady is there and kept asking the medium where her husband was as it seems she's without him and cannot find him.

There is indeed a man who walks around upstairs, and he is the mischievous one that kicked the dog and was seen walking past the telly and outlined in the doorway. Also this week, another member of the family got hit by him on the head- so hard it made her cry! But according to the medium, when they were talking about this, the spirit was with them and was laughing about it. Apparently because he's a big man he doesn't realise his own strength when he does these impish things. He's not malicious, he's just mischievous and likes people to know he's around, which is why he likes playing tricks on people.

Lastly, they picked up on an entity around the small bar area, and the medium picked up on the name "Jim". This has coincided with a photograph taken in this area, which I've posted below, and they noticed there appears to be what looks like a face in the black shelf.

Now they were sitting at the bar looking at this photograph when my neighbour came in....knew nothing of the investigation or anything that was discussed.......he took one look at the photo 'face' and said "That's Jimmy!", who is apparently a long-dead customer of the pub ohmy.gif

I know the face there could be a trick of the light or a reflection, but what an amazing coincidence when it's coupled with the medium picking up Jim and my neighbour coming out with Jimmy as the face, when he didn't know anything about the medium's visit.

There will be more information, but I've not had chance to fully touch base with my pal yet. But so far, what an interesting visit it was and lots for me to get cracking on trying to check facts on in records office etc.
